The question of whether schizophrenia is associated with structural or functional abnormalities of the nervous system, or both, has become the principal focus of biological studies of schizophrenia. Computed tomography studies have revealed ventricular enlargement and cortical atrophy in a subgroup of schizophrenic patients. WebDifferent disorders respond to drug therapy differently. Some disorders are managed very effectively with biological therapies, others respond better to counseling, and some require the use of both. For example, the primary treatment of schizophrenia is antipsychotic medication, but it can be combined with psychosocial interventions like therapy.
